Yes, this is common blue.

The cell spot on the underside of the forewing is the giveaway. Although there are some other similar species with a cell spot (the genus Lysandra, for example) the overall appearance confirms common blue. It is not uncommon for the orange lunules to be rather worn, as here, though you are right - a typical fresh specimen is much brighter.
